Job description
An opportunity to work as an Administration Assistant within DynamicHealth’s Musculoskeletal Physiotherapy and Specialist Services at Princess of Wales Hospital, Ely (CB6). This fixed‑term, full‑time role (37.5 hours, Band 2, 12 months) runs Monday–Friday 08:00–16:00 and offers hands‑on NHS admin experience supporting clinics across Cambridgeshire and Peterborough. You’ll be the first point of contact on reception and phone, using SystmOne to book, triage and manage referrals and waiting lists, send appointment SMS invites, process correspondence, support medicine management and interpreter bookings, and help maintain accurate patient records while following confidentiality and infection‑control policies.
This post suits organised, empathetic people — especially carers or women seeking reliable daytime hours and a supportive workplace — who enjoy varied admin duties and helping improve patient pathways. The Trust is CQC‑rated Outstanding and places strong emphasis on staff engagement, training and development. GCSEs in English and Maths (or equivalent), basic IT skills and the ability to travel between sites are required; a DBS check and possible sponsorship considerations apply. Useful skills for an Administration Assistant:
Click to view
To work as an Administration Assistant in the UK, you'll need a mix of technical, organizational, and interpersonal skills. Here are some essential skills and qualifications:
Essential Skills
1. Organizational Skills: Ability to manage multiple tasks, prioritize workload, and maintain clear systems for filing and information retrieval.
2. Communication Skills: Strong written and verbal communication skills to interact effectively with colleagues, clients, and stakeholders.
3. IT Proficiency: Familiarity with office software (e.g., Microsoft Office Suite, especially Word, Excel, PowerPoint, and Outlook) and basic knowledge of data management systems.
4. Attention to Detail: Accuracy in completing tasks, managing data, and producing documents.
5. Time Management: Ability to meet deadlines and manage time effectively in a busy work environment.
6. Problem-Solving Skills: Capability to identify issues and find practical solutions.
7. Customer Service Skills: A professional approach to dealing with both internal and external customers.
8. Teamwork: Ability to work collaboratively in a team environment.
9. Adaptability: Flexibility to adapt to changing tasks and priorities as needed.
Qualifications
- Educational Background: A good general education, typically a minimum of GCSEs in English and Maths.
- Relevant Experience: Previous administrative or office experience can be advantageous.
- Professional Qualifications: While not always necessary, qualifications in administration, business, or related fields (e.g., NVQ or BTEC) may enhance your prospects.
- Familiarity with Office Technology: Knowledge of office equipment (printers, copiers, etc.) and possibly specific software relevant to the industry you're applying to.
Additional Considerations
- Confidentiality Awareness: Understanding the importance of handling sensitive information appropriately.
- Basic Financial Knowledge: Some roles may require basic budgeting or invoicing skills.
